Definitions:

Social Institutions

Established systems within a society that structure behavior and interactions according to collective goals and norms, such as family, education, religion, and the economy.

Gender Inequality

The social, economic, and cultural condition in which genders are not treated equally, leading to disparities in access, rights, and opportunities.

Self-Actualization

is the process of realizing and fulfilling one's potential and capabilities, often considered the highest stage of psychological development in Maslow's hierarchy of needs.

Societal Organization

The structured ways in which societies are organized around relationships of governance, production, distribution, and social interaction.
